Output 707216819682afca34211191289d9f8d37014b169f5592cbb17e392b64783be9:1

value
2322595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015d307b7c529ac993b177482d47718ed57c04dd OP_EQUAL
address
M82NYXvTPRYRzr5833bK9UTXag4J2ubjxK
transaction
707216819682afca34211191289d9f8d37014b169f5592cbb17e392b64783be9
spent
true